How the Bitci.com Scam Model May Work
If Bitci.com is indeed a fraudulent platform, its operation likely follows a model similar to other crypto scams:
-
Attraction Phase: The platform lures users with marketing campaigns, token airdrops, or investment opportunities.
-
Deposit Stage: Users fund their accounts with crypto or fiat currencies.
-
Trading Manipulation: The platform inflates balances or shows fake profits to build trust.
-
Withdrawal Block: When users attempt to withdraw, the site delays or denies requests.
-
Disappearance or Rebranding: Once complaints increase, the operators may abandon the platform or relaunch it under a new name.
This cycle has been observed in multiple unregulated exchanges posing as legitimate trading platforms.
